Bibanpur Population - Ramabai Nagar, Uttar Pradesh

Bibanpur is a medium size village located in Sikandra Tehsil of Ramabai Nagar district, Uttar Pradesh with total 93 families residing. The Bibanpur village has population of 531 of which 304 are males while 227 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bibanp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 54 which makes up 10.17 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bibanpur village is 747 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Bibanpur as per census is 800,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Bibanp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Bibanpur village was 70.65 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Bibanpur Male literacy stands at 79.20 % while female literacy rate was 59.11 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 18.83 % of total population in Bibanpur village. The village Bibanpur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Bibanpur village out of total population, 224 were engaged in work activities. 99.55 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.45 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 224 workers engaged in Main Work, 95 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 87 were Agricultural labourer.
